Report details in Workday Adaptive Planning provide essential information to help users understand the context and relevance of the report. The details typically include the output type, which specifies the format in which the report is generated (e.g., PDF, Excel). The owner of the report indicates who created or maintains the report, providing a point of contact for any questions about its content. Lastly, the last viewed date informs users about the most recent interaction with the report, which can be crucial for ensuring that the data is current or understanding how frequently the report is accessed.
